| diff --git a/Trac-1.0.1.orig/trac/versioncontrol/web_ui/changeset.py b/Trac-1.0.1/trac/versioncontrol/web_ui/changeset.py | |
| index e33bd1f..5ef6f77 100644 | |
| --- a/Trac-1.0.1.orig/trac/versioncontrol/web_ui/changeset.py | |
| +++ b/Trac-1.0.1/trac/versioncontrol/web_ui/changeset.py | |
| @@ -1101,6 +1101,9 @@ class ChangesetModule(Component): | |
| "on %(repos)s", rev=rev, | |
| repos=reponame or _('(default)')) | |
| elif reponame: | |
| + return tag.a(label, class_="changeset", | |
| + title="changeset", | |
| + href="http://git.videolan.org/?p=ffmpeg.git;a=commit;h=" + fragment) | |
| errmsg = _("Repository '%(repo)s' not found", repo=reponame) | |
| else: | |
| errmsg = _("No default repository defined") | |
| diff --git a/Trac-1.0.1.orig/tracopt/versioncontrol/git/git_fs.py b/Trac-1.0.1/tracopt/versioncontrol/git/git_fs.py | |
| index 3802d7f..636a555 100644 | |
| --- a/Trac-1.0.1.orig/tracopt/versioncontrol/git/git_fs.py | |
| +++ b/Trac-1.0.1/tracopt/versioncontrol/git/git_fs.py | |
| @@ -151,8 +151,8 @@ class GitConnector(Component): | |
| title=shorten_line(changeset.message), | |
| href=formatter.href.changeset(sha, repos.reponame)) | |
| except Exception, e: | |
| - return tag.a(label, class_='missing changeset', | |
| - title=to_unicode(e), rel='nofollow') | |
| + return tag.a(label, class_='changeset', | |
| + title='Changeset ' + sha, href="http://git.videolan.org/?p=ffmpeg.git;a=commit;h=" + sha) | |
| def get_wiki_syntax(self): | |
| yield (r'(?:\b|!)r?[0-9a-fA-F]{%d,40}\b' % self.wiki_shortrev_len, |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ment